Kinesio Taping

Kinesio Taping was developed at the beginning of the 70s by a Japanese physician and chiropractor Dr. Kenzo Kase

Kinesio Taping consists of „Kinesis” = Greek for „movement“ and „Taping” = English for “fixing with a tape”.

The tapes will be placed onto pre-stretched muscles and joints. Moving the muscle or the joint leads to a permanent shifting of the skin and the subcutaneous skin, which again leads to an activation of the muscles, ligaments or joints underneath as well as to an activation of the lymph flow, which brings the positive therapeutic effect. An additional benefit of the Kinesio Taping: since the pain often stops immediately, relieving postures and consequential problems, such as tensions, are prevented.

Main application fields: different kind of pain, (sport)injuries of muscles, joints and bones (e.g. back, knee, ankle, shoulder, tennis/golf arm, torn muscle fibre, pulled muscle, compression, bruise)

Contra indications: skin diseases, patch allergy
